By Athan Agbakwuru, Owerri
The former deputy governor of Imo State, Prince Eze Madumere, has indicated interest in the governorship race of Imo State, in 2027 saying he has marshalled out a blueprint tailored towards the needs of the people.
Prince Madumere who celebrated his 61st birthday weekend, in a statement, urged the citizenry to hang on for the big beautiful deal, trust and believe for a future laced up with policies for sustainable development as against endless hope and twists.
